since the 70’s and the socialist government policies. Nowadays, the bulk of planted <strong>coffee</strong>s (if<br />

it is not the whole) are selected varieties. So far there are 14 <strong>coffee</strong> selected cultivars released<br />

and cultivated in <strong>Limu</strong> Kosa woreda (and 18 in whole <strong>coffee</strong> areas of south western and<br />

western regi<strong>on</strong>s of the country):<br />

Table 3: <strong>Limu</strong> Kosa selected <strong>coffee</strong> cultivars (CPDE, 2005)<br />

These cultivars are <strong>coffee</strong> berry disease (CBD) resistant, results of the Jima<br />

Agricultural Research Centre. Compared with some other producing countries average yields,<br />

Ethiopian <strong>on</strong>es appeared to be lower and not satisfactory; noticing this, the latter Ethiopian<br />

institute, with stati<strong>on</strong>s in principal growing regi<strong>on</strong>s, is working at the development and use of<br />

improved <strong>coffee</strong> varieties, mainly for disease resistance and high yield through the following<br />

research work procedure (Banttee, 1995):<br />

15 Open, intermediate and compact respectively point out big, middle and little canopy covered area.<br />

16 These altitudinal z<strong>on</strong>es vary according to scientists but, in the classificati<strong>on</strong> of the Jima Research Center, high<br />

lands (dega) are > 1750 masl, mid lands (woïnadega) > 1550 masl and low lands (kola) < 1550 masl.<br />
